I raced this morning at a local 5K put on by the YMCA which took place at Washington Park, located a mere two blocks from my doorstep. I did a recon run of the course on Thursday and found that it was considerably more hilly than I had originally anticipated. In fact, I only made it through 2 miles of the recon run and called it a day out of frustration (and perhaps tired legs from the previous day's bike workout). Never-the-less, I raced this morning.
To back up a bit, about a month ago, my wife's co-worker, an Ohio State alum and overly cocky goatee-ridden man, also signed up to run the race. He asked me how fast I thought I could run it in and I threw out 7:30 min/mile averages (although my current PR stood at a 7:42 min/mile). He said that's about where he was at too and the race was officially "on" from there. I had nailed a few 7:24 min/mile averages in training leading up to the race so I felt good, but not confident that I had anything close to a win wrapped up by ANY means.
Fast forward to race-morning and I meet up with him at the park and exchange pleasantries. He's dressed in his scarlet and gray and me in my U of M tech shirt. I notice he isn't wearing a watch so I offer to pace for us both since I had on my Garmin Forerunner 305. He agrees, but says he'd love to shoot for finishing the 5K in 22:00, or less!!.. I didn't want to show my hand so I just said "sounds good" and went from there.
